ill-gotten
adjective/ˌɪl ˈɡɒtn/
/ˌɪl ˈɡɑːtn/
(old-fashioned or humorous)- obtained dishonestly or unfairly
- ill-gotten gains (= money that was not obtained fairly)
- His ill-gotten millions are all safely stashed away in a Swiss bank.
Oxford Collocations DictionaryIll-gotten is used with these nouns:- gain
